  • ✅ Do you forget opening variations in your repertoire, even after memorizing them? In this lesson, GM Avetik Grigoryan shares a very important tip that can help you remember your preparation better.
    ✅ You will also see how one idea from an opening can be used in another, even when the colors are reversed!
